6 DEDICATED INSTRUCTIONS
6.6 RECVS Instruction (for Interrupt Programs)
This instruction reads received data.

Set data Description Set by Data type
"Un"
Start I/O signal of the local station's Ethernet net module.
(00 to FE: The higher 2 digits of the 3-digit I/O signal.)
User Character string
(S) Head device of the local station that stores the control data. User, system
(D1) Head device of the local station that stores the receive data.
Device name
(D2) (Designate as dummy.)
System
Bit
The local devices and the file register for each program cannot be used as devices
used in setting data.
POINT
The RECV instruction can be executed only when the local station is a QCPU.
REMARK
The number of steps for the RECV instruction is 10.
